多重签名账户是一种通过需要多个私钥来授权交易的机制,这在区块链和加密货币领域中得到了广泛应用。与传统的单一私钥控制账户相比,多重签名账户提供了更高的安全性和灵活性。
在多重签名形式中,账户可以设置多个密钥,只有当预设的密钥数量提供签名时,才能执行交易。这种机制不仅防止单点故障,降低资金被盗风险,还可以实现更灵活的权限管理,例如在企业或组织内的财务管理中,确保所有重要交易都能经过多个管理者的同意。
### 多重签名账户的创建与设置 #### 如何创建多重签名账户创建多重签名账户的第一步是选择支持这种功能的加密钱包。许多现代加密钱包,例如Electrum, BitGo或Coinbase Custody等,都支持多重签名功能。以下是创建多重签名账户的一些基本步骤:
1. **选择钱包**:选择一个支持多重签名的加密钱包并下载或访问其在线平台。 2. **创建新账户**:在钱包的界面中,寻找“创建钱包”或“新账户”的选项。 3. **选择多重签名类型**:在账户设置中,选择多重签名选项。你需要决定需要多少个密钥以及多少个密钥用于授权(例如,2-of-3,意味着有三个密钥,但至少需要两个密钥进行交易)。 4. **添加成员**:输入参与该多重签名的每个成员的公钥或者设置他们的电子邮件地址/联系方式。 5. **确认设置**:确保所有的设置准确无误,最后确认创建该多重签名账户。 6. **备份密钥**:每个密钥成员需要备份他们的私钥,以免丢失访问权限。 #### 交易授权的过程进行多重签名账户交易时,通常需要以下步骤:
1. **发起交易**:一个成员(提议人)发起交易,指定接收方地址和交易金额,并将交易信息广播给其他成员进行签名。 2. **签名交易**:其他需要签名的成员使用他们各自的私钥对交易进行签名。这个过程可能需要使用钱包中的界面或命令行工具。 3. **提交交易**:一旦达到预设的签名数量(例如,在2-of-3的情况下至少有两个成员签名),交易将被提交到区块链网络中进行处理。 4. **确认交易**:交易一旦被矿工打包并包含在区块中,它就被视为成功,这笔资金会转移到接收方指定的地址。 ### 多重签名的优势与劣势 #### 优势多重签名账户交易的主要优势在于提升了安全性:
1. **防止单点故障**:单个私钥丢失或泄露将不会影响整个账户的安全性。在多重签名环境下,哪怕一个密钥被盗,攻击者也无法轻易转移资金。 2. **提高透明度和监督**:在企业环境中,多重签名可以确保所有的重要交易都由多个管理员进行审批,避免滥用资金。 3. **简化合作**:对于团队合作或伙伴关系而言,多重签名可以设定一个协议,确保所有成员在进行任何重大决策时拥有相同的权利。 #### 劣势尽管多重签名账户有许多优点,但也可能存在一些缺点:
1. **复杂性**:相比单签名钱包,多重签名设置和管理更加复杂,特别是对于技术能力较低的用户。 2. **协调问题**:在需要多个成员签名的情况下,协调成员的时间与活动可能会导致交易延迟。 3. **依赖于成员**:如果某个关键成员未能参与并签名,交易可能会被阻止,甚至延误甚至无法完成。 ### 相关问题探讨 #### 多重签名账户适合哪些场景?多重签名账户适合哪些场景?
多重签名账户在许多场景中都可以发挥其独特的优势。以下是一些典型的应用场景:
1. **企业资金管理**:企业可使用多重签名账户管理资金,确保多个高管或财务主管在资金使用上达成共识,降低财务风险。 2. **合作项目**:在合作开发或投资项目中,多重签名可以确保所有参与方都有权对资金动用进行监督,从而降低纠纷风险。 3. **发放薪酬**:许多项目团队可以使用多重签名账户进行薪酬发放,确保项目负责人、财务和人事部门三个方面的人员均达成一致后才可进行资金流动。 4. **资产管理**:在资产管理公司,多重签名可以防止单个财务顾问的不当操作,确保在做出投资决策时有多个独立的意见。 5. **遗产管理**:多重签名也可用于遗产管理,确保在遗嘱执行时需要多方共同确认后才能解锁资产。以上各种应用场景都表明,多重签名账户具有广泛的适用性,尤其是在需要加强安全性和合规性的情况下更是不可或缺。
#### 如何保障多重签名的安全性?如何保障多重签名的安全性?
尽管多重签名本身提高了账户的安全性,但管理好这些私钥和签名过程是确保整体安全的关键。以下是一些保障措施:
1. **使用硬件钱包**:硬件钱包是一种物理设备,安全性高,不易受到网络攻击,适合存储私钥。 2. **定期备份**:定期备份每个签名成员的私钥和相关信息,防止由于意外事件(如设备故障)导致无法访问账户。 3. **使用多重签名钱包的安全功能**:许多现代多重签名钱包提供了额外的安全功能,例如双重身份验证(2FA),应积极启用。 4. **限制接入权限**:对于多重签名账户的成员,权限应当仅限于执行必要的交易,避免不必要的暴露。 5. **教育与培训**:对于多重签名账户的使用者进行网络安全和隐私保护的教育培训,确保所有成员知道如何安全地管理他们的私钥。 6. **定期审计**:定期对多重签名账户的活动进行审计,以发现潜在的可疑活动,能够及时改进以达到最佳安全状态。 #### 多重签名账户与传统单签名账户的比较多重签名账户与传统单签名账户的比较
多重签名与单签名账户各有优缺点,下面将从不同的方面进行比较:
1. **安全性**: - 多重签名账户:通过需要多个私钥来进行交易,单个密钥的丢失或泄露,攻击者无法轻易获得账户的控制权。 - 单签名账户:安全性较低,单个私钥若丢失或被盗,攻击者可以轻易控制账户。 2. **管理方便性**: - 多重签名账户:相对复杂,需要多个成员协调合作,交易的发起与执行流程可能较为繁琐。 - 单签名账户:简单易用,一个人即可控制,一旦掌握密钥,资金即可自由进出。 3. **费用**: - 多重签名账户:由于交易确认时需要多个签名,可能产生额外的交易费用,尤其在确认网络繁忙时。 - 单签名账户:手续费相对较低,尤其在交易量较小的情况下,相对节省成本。 4. **适用场景**: - 多重签名账户:适用于需要多人管控的情境,如企业账目、合伙人投资等,对安全性要求较高。 - 单签名账户:适用范围广泛,尤其适合个人用户,简单方便。综上所述,选择哪种账户类型取决于用户的具体需求、安全考虑以及操作的复杂性。一些情况下,用户可能会同时使用多重签名和单签名账户,以便在不同场景下发挥各自优势。
#### 多重签名账户在实际操作中的常见问题及解决方法多重签名账户在实际操作中的常见问题及解决方法
在实际进行多重签名账户操作时,用户可能会面临一些常见问题,以下是这些问题及其解决方案:
1. **私钥丢失**: - **问题**:某个成员因为不小心丢失了他们的私钥,导致多重签名账户无法正常交易。 - **解决方案**:建议用户在创建多重签名账户时,事先做好私钥的备份。在丢失的情况下,可以通过设置新的多重签名账户,将所有成员私钥转移至新账户确保资金安全。 2. **成员失联**: - **问题**:在多重签名账户中,如果某个成员不再参与项目或失联,可能会造成交易无法批准的情况。 - **解决方案**:在多重签名账户的设置之初,在参与方之间达成共识,设定明确的规则和替代者。如果有必要另外帧成员,重新分配新的参与者,确保在成员变更过程中不影响账户的正常使用。 3. **交易延误**: - **问题**:由于成员不同步签名,导致交易长时间未被确认。 - **解决方案**:可设定一个提前通知机制,一旦有人发起交易,其他成员应在规定的时间内进行签名,提高交易效率。 4. **钱包安全问题**: - **问题**:用户可能会遭遇到网络攻击,试图获取私钥,或其设备受到病毒感染。 - **解决方案**:使用知名品牌和高评价的加密钱包,定期更新软件,另外还应使用复杂的密码,避免随意链接不安全的网络和设备。多重签名账户在为用户提供高度安全的同时,也伴随着一定的操作复杂性。了解潜在的问题并提前制定应对措施,可以提高多重签名账户的使用体验,但应特别关注安全性,确保保护用户的资产安全。
以上内容为对多重签名账户交易的全面解析,希望能为你提供详细的了解和实际操作中的指导。